HPS Grow LightsWhat are HPS (High Pressure Sodium) Lights and How Do They Work?

While there are many different kinds of grow lights, HPS (High Pressure Sodium) grow lights are the best for blooming and fruiting. Because HPS lights produce light in the red and orange spectrums, which are appropriate for these applications, this is the case.

They are made up of a sodium-filled glass bulb, a ballast, and a reflector. HPS grow lights are meant to be used in addition to, not in instead of, natural sunshine.

Wattage of the ballast

The operation of HPS grow lights necessitates the use of a tiny power transformer known as a ballast. For electricity, this ballast plugs straight into a wall socket, and a waterproof wire connects it to the reflector. The wattage of the ballast determines the maximum wattage of an HPS bulb that may be used in the system. The greater the wattage, the more space a single bulb can illuminate. Consumer-grade ballasts vary in power from 100 to 1000 watts and operate on 120 or 240 volts. When choosing a ballast, make sure it’s suitable with a reflector and bulb that can withstand the wattage.

HPS Bulbs

HPS grow light bulbs are fairly pricey, however that is due to the fact that they are a specialist bulb. They’re programmed to solely emit colors in the orange and red spectrums, which are perfect for promoting plant development during blooming. Some HPS bulbs now have higher power and the capacity to emit blue light, making them more versatile. As previously mentioned, your HPS bulb should be chosen depending on the ballast’s power. They may not appear like a standard bulb, but they are screwed in the same manner. HPS grow lights should only be used to boost plant development during blooming, not to replace sunlight.

Reflectors

HPS grow lamp reflectors are often made of aluminum and serve the role of supporting the bulb and reflecting its light into a powerful beam. The reflector is usually suspended on a chain or cable several feet above the ground. The reflectors with the power line already attached are the most convenient to use. Some branded reflectors can only be used with ballast power supply of the same brand. In many circumstances, a glass panel that swings open for access will conceal the HPS light. Condensation does not form around the bulb or electrical components because of the glass panel.
